maritime.wxml 2.1 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748
  1. <view class="container">
  2. <!-- 顶部标题 -->
  3. <!-- 内容区域 -->
  4. <view class="content">
  5. <!-- 海事公告列表 -->
  6. <view class="card">
  7. <view class="card-header">海事公告</view>
  8. <view class="card-content">
  9. <scroll-view class="notice-scroll" scroll-y="true" bindscrolltolower="onScrollToLower" refresher-enabled="true" refresher-triggered="{{isRefreshing}}" bindrefresherrefresh="onPullDownRefresh">
  10. <view class="notice-list">
  11. <view wx:if="{{notices.length === 0 && !isLoading}}" class="empty-tip">暂无海事公告</view>
  12. <view class="notice-item" wx:for="{{notices}}" wx:key="id" bindtap="viewNoticeDetail" data-id="{{item.id}}">
  13. <view class="notice-title">{{item.title}}</view>
  14. <view class="notice-info">
  15. <text class="notice-date">{{item.date}}</text>
  16. <text class="notice-unit">{{item.unit}}</text>
  17. </view>
  18. </view>
  19. <view wx:if="{{isLoading}}" class="loading">加载中...</view>
  20. <view wx:if="{{!hasMore && notices.length > 0}}" class="no-more">没有更多数据了</view>
  21. </view>
  22. </scroll-view>
  23. </view>
  24. </view>
  25. <!-- 法律援助机构介绍 -->
  26. <view class="card">
  27. <view class="card-header">法律援助机构</view>
  28. <view class="card-content">
  29. <view class="org-info">
  30. <view class="org-name">{{legalOrg.name}}</view>
  31. <image class="org-photo" mode="aspectFit" src="{{legalOrg.photoUrl}}"></image>
  32. <view class="org-intro">{{legalOrg.introduction}}</view>
  33. </view>
  34. </view>
  35. </view>
  36. <!-- 法律援助申请 -->
  37. <view class="card">
  38. <view class="card-header">申请法律援助</view>
  39. <view class="card-content">
  40. <view class="legal-aid-form">
  41. <textarea class="aid-input" placeholder="请描述您的法律援助需求..." bindinput="handleInputChange" value="{{aidRequest}}"></textarea>
  42. <view class="submit-btn" bindtap="submitAidRequest">提交申请</view>
  43. </view>
  44. </view>
  45. </view>
  46. </view>
  47. </view>
  48. <view class="h200"></view>